From d9a3b754d14f93375cd3d91afa49be8deb07975c Mon Sep 17 00:00:00 2001
From: Administrator <admin@example.com>
Date: 星期三, 26 六月 2024 16:37:15 +0800
Subject: [PATCH] 订阅bug修改

---
 huaxin_client/l2_data_manager.py |   10 ++++++++--
 1 files changed, 8 insertions(+), 2 deletions(-)

diff --git a/huaxin_client/l2_data_manager.py b/huaxin_client/l2_data_manager.py
index d56ec5f..e62e624 100644
--- a/huaxin_client/l2_data_manager.py
+++ b/huaxin_client/l2_data_manager.py
@@ -132,9 +132,15 @@
             callback.OnMarketData(code, data)
 
     # 鍒嗛厤涓婁紶闃熷垪
-    def distribute_upload_queue(self, code):
+    def distribute_upload_queue(self, code, _target_codes=None):
+        """
+        鍒嗛厤涓婁紶闃熷垪
+        @param code: 浠g爜
+        @param _target_codes: 鎵�鏈夌殑鐩爣浠g爜
+        @return:
+        """
         if not self.data_callback_distribute_manager.get_distributed_callback(code):
-            self.data_callback_distribute_manager.distribute_callback(code)
+            self.data_callback_distribute_manager.distribute_callback(code, _target_codes)
 
         if code not in self.temp_order_queue_dict:
             self.temp_order_queue_dict[code] = collections.deque()

--
Gitblit v1.8.0